A feeder process is any business process that accumulates business event data that are then communicated to and processed within the GL.

Norepinephrine
A neurotransmitter and hormone involved in the body's response to stress, increasing heart rate, blood pressure, and sugar levels in the brain.
Reinforcement
In psychology, any event that strengthens or increases the likelihood of a specific response or behavior by providing a consequence an individual finds rewarding.
